An ice and water shield, also known as an ice and water barrier, is a crucial component of roofing systems in regions prone to ice dams and heavy snowfall. It is a self-adhesive, rubberized asphalt membrane installed on the roof deck, typically in the areas most vulnerable to water infiltration, such as along eaves, valleys, and around roof ... An ice and water shield has two main purposes. First, it prevents ice dams from forming along the roof’s perimeter in winter. For this reason, building code requires ice and water shields for homes in northern climates and in regions with cold winters. An ice dam is especially worrisome as it forms once water refreezes on a roof’s edge.

An …The ice and water shield works by sealing around nails, fasteners, and other penetration points, preventing water from seeping through and causing damage. Its self-adhesive nature allows it to bond directly to the roof deck, ensuring a continuous, watertight seal. Ice and water protector, sometimes also referred to as “peel and stick”, is a waterproof roof underlayment membrane developed to protect vulnerable areas on a roof from ice and water damage. Ice and water protectors (sometimes called ice and snow shields in cold climates) are made with polymer-modified bitumen. An ice and water shield is a modified self adhered leak barrier. It comes in a sheet with split back release film similar to a self-stick or peel-and-stick. It seals itself around the nails used in shingling.
